Skeleton Printable Coloring Pages - The human skeleton is the internal framework for the human body. The human skeleton can be divided into the axial skeleton and the appendicular skeleton. The axial skeleton is formed by the spinal column, the rib cage, the skull, and associated bones. The skeletal system includes over 200 bones, cartilage, and ligaments.
